private void btnOnayla_Click(object sender, EventArgs e) { string turAd = Convert.ToString(comboTur.SelectedItem); if (turAd != null) { using (data.massTurEntities db = new data.massTurEntities()) { seciliTur = db.Tur.Where(t => t.ad == turAd).FirstOrDefault(); if (seciliTur != null) { if (seciliTur.bitTarih != null) { DateTime bitTarih = (DateTime)seciliTur.bitTarih; labelBitTarih.Text = bitTarih.ToString("dd/MM/yyyy"); } if (seciliTur.basTarih != null) { DateTime basTarih = (DateTime)seciliTur.basTarih; labelBasTarih.Text = basTarih.ToString("dd/MM/yyyy"); } labelKod.Text = seciliTur.kod; groupTurBilgi.Visible = true; int padding = 0; int y = 20; foreach (data.Parkur p in seciliTur.Parkur.ToList()) { GroupControl gc = new GroupControl(); ////gc.AutoSize = true; gc.Width = 75; gc.Height = 75; gc.Location = new Point(padding, y); PictureBox pic = new PictureBox(); pic.SizeMode = PictureBoxSizeMode.StretchImage; pic.Dock = DockStyle.Fill; gc.Text = p.sehir + "(" + p.sira + ")"; if (p.ulasim == "Uçak") { pic.Image = Image.FromFile("../../data\\images\\AWT-Plane.png"); } else if (p.ulasim == "Otobüs") { pic.Image = Image.FromFile("../../data/images/AWT-Bus.png"); } gc.Controls.Add(pic); groupParkur.Controls.Add(gc); groupParkur.Visible = true; padding += 75; if (padding > 300) { padding = 0; y += 75; } } } } } }
void yeniMusteri() { data.Musteri m = new data.Musteri(); try { m.TCMusteriNo = txtTC.Text.ToString(); m.ad = txtAd.Text.ToString(); m.soyad = txtSoyad.Text.ToString(); m.dogumYer = txtDogumYeri.Text.ToString(); m.dogumTarih = dateEditDogumTarihi.DateTime; m.anneAd = txtAnneAd.Text.ToString(); m.babaAd = txtBabaAd.Text.ToString(); m.cinsiyet = comboBoxCinsiyet.SelectedItem.ToString(); if (comboBoxVatandas.SelectedItem.ToString() == "Türk") { m.vatandas = true; } else { m.vatandas = false; } m.medeniDurum = comboBoxMedeni.SelectedItem.ToString(); m.turu = comboBoxMusteriTuru.SelectedItem.ToString(); m.basvuruTipi = comboBoxBasvuruTipi.SelectedItem.ToString(); m.grup = txtGrup.Text.ToString(); m.ogrenci = (bool)(radioOgr.EditValue); m.ogrenciBelge = (bool)(radioOgrBelge.EditValue); m.cepTel = txtCepTel.Text.ToString(); m.adres = txtAdres.Text.ToString(); m.acilAd = txtAcilAd.Text.ToString(); m.acilYakinlik = txtAcilYakinlik.Text.ToString(); m.acilNo = txtAcilNo.Text.ToString(); m.faturaAdres = txtFaturaAdres.Text.ToString(); m.passID = 0; m.aktif = true; using (data.massTurEntities db = new data.massTurEntities()) { db.Musteri.Add(m); db.SaveChanges(); } mesaj.YeniKayit("Yeni müşteri kaydı oluşturuldu"); Temizle(); } catch (Exception e) { mesaj.Hata(e); } }
private void comboDonem_SelectedIndexChanged(object sender, EventArgs e) { string sezon = comboSezon.SelectedItem.ToString(); string donem = comboDonem.SelectedItem.ToString(); comboTur.Properties.Items.Clear(); using (data.massTurEntities db = new data.massTurEntities()) { foreach (data.Tur tur in db.Tur.Where(t => t.Donem.ad.Contains(donem) && t.Sezon.ad.Contains(sezon)).ToList()) { comboTur.Properties.Items.Add(tur.ad); } } }
void listele() { list.Rows.Clear(); using (data.massTurEntities db = new data.massTurEntities()) { foreach (data.Musteri m in db.Musteri.Where(mus => mus.aktif == true).ToList()) { string dogumTarih = Convert.ToString(m.dogumTarih); list.Rows.Add(m.id, m.TCMusteriNo, m.ad, m.soyad, m.cinsiyet, m.dogumYer, dogumTarih, m.cepTel); } } gridMusteriList.DataSource = list; }
private void btnAra_Click(object sender, EventArgs e) { TCKN = txtTC.Text.ToString(); using (data.massTurEntities db = new data.massTurEntities()) { seciliMusteri = db.Musteri.Where(m => m.TCMusteriNo == TCKN).FirstOrDefault(); if (seciliMusteri != null) { groupKisiBilgi.Visible = true; labelAd.Text = seciliMusteri.ad; labelSoyad.Text = seciliMusteri.soyad; } else { mesaj.MusteriBulunamadi(); txtTC.Text = ""; } } }
private void comboBoxDoldur() { comboSezon.Text = "Seçiniz"; comboDonem.Text = "Seçiniz"; comboTur.Text = "Seçiniz"; comboDonem.Properties.Items.Clear(); comboSezon.Properties.Items.Clear(); using (data.massTurEntities db = new data.massTurEntities()) { foreach (data.Sezon s in db.Sezon.Where(sez => sez.aktif == true).ToList()) { comboSezon.Properties.Items.Add(s.ad); } foreach (data.Donem d in db.Donem.Where(don => don.aktif == true).ToList()) { comboDonem.Properties.Items.Add(d.ad); } } }
void Ara() { using (data.massTurEntities db = new data.massTurEntities()) { try { var arama = db.Musteri.Where(m => m.TCMusteriNo.Contains(txtTC.Text.ToString()) || m.ad.Contains(txtAd.Text.ToString()) || m.soyad.Contains(txtSoyad.Text.ToString())).ToList(); list.Rows.Clear(); foreach (var m in arama.Where(a => a.aktif == true).ToList()) { string dogumTarih = Convert.ToString(m.dogumTarih); list.Rows.Add(m.id, m.TCMusteriNo, m.ad, m.soyad, m.cinsiyet, m.dogumYer, dogumTarih, m.cepTel); } } catch (Exception e) { mesajlar.Hata(e); } } gridMusteriList.DataSource = list; }